Job Summary

• Work closely with HR Manager and assist in carrying out the related tasks.
• Perform a full range of administrative functions.
• Processing paperwork and ensuring all paperwork adheres to guidelines

Duties & Responsibilities

1. Maintain personnel files and records
2. Responsible for all filing of incoming and outgoing official letters/memos etc and management of records.
3. Holding weekly meetings with support staff
4. Taking care of cleanliness of office and office environment
5.Control and supervision of support staff
6. Planning and Scheduling of Office hours for support staff and guards
7. Taking care of office equipments such as photo copy machine
8. Keeping track of Leaves, absenteeism, staff tours and grievances
9.Provide advice and assistance in developing human resource plans.
10. Provide assistance in staff orientations.
11. Prepare notices and advertisements for vacant staff positions.
12. Schedule and organize interviews.
13.Conduct reference checks on possible candidates.
14.Prepare, develop and implement procedures and policies on staff recruitment.
15.Other duties as prescribed.
